I recently learned that the aluminum trees were very popular from the late 50s to the mid-60s. Then the Charlie Brown Christmas Special (1965) made fun of the metal ones, and their popularity died almost overnight. After the Special aired, sales of aluminum trees went to practically nothing, and within a couple of years the metal ones were discontinued.
